What is the Midcoast Scanner Page?

The Midcoast Scanner Page is essentially a hub that aggregates information from various sources, primarily police scanners, fire departments, and emergency medical services in the Midcoast region. But it's more than just a raw data feed; it's a curated platform where volunteers and community members often help to filter, verify, and contextualize the information. This means you're not just getting a jumble of scanner chatter, but rather a stream of relevant and understandable updates. Imagine trying to listen to a police scanner yourself – you'd be bombarded with technical jargon and codes. The Midcoast Scanner Page takes that raw information and translates it into plain English (or as close to it as possible!), making it accessible to everyone. It’s a fantastic way to stay informed about what’s happening in real-time without needing to invest in expensive equipment or learn complicated radio protocols. For instance, you might see updates on traffic accidents causing delays on your usual commute, allowing you to find alternative routes. Or perhaps there’s a community event causing road closures – the scanner page will keep you in the loop. Moreover, during emergencies like severe weather or natural disasters, the Midcoast Scanner Page becomes an invaluable tool for receiving critical information and staying safe. How to Access and Use the Midcoast Scanner Page

Gaining access to the Midcoast Scanner Page is usually pretty straightforward. Most scanner pages operate through various social media platforms, particularly Facebook. Simply search for "Midcoast Scanner Page" on Facebook, and you'll likely find a dedicated group or page. Once you've located it, request to join the group or like the page to start receiving updates in your news feed. Another common way to access these updates is through dedicated websites or apps that aggregate scanner information. These platforms often provide more organized and searchable feeds, allowing you to filter information based on location, type of incident, or keyword. When using the Midcoast Scanner Page, it's important to keep a few things in mind. First, remember that the information is often preliminary and subject to change. Scanner reports are based on real-time communications, which means there can be inaccuracies or evolving details. Always verify critical information with official sources before taking action. Second, be mindful of the language and terminology used on the page. Scanner communications often involve codes and abbreviations that might not be immediately clear. Look for explanations or glossaries to help you understand the updates. Finally, consider contributing to the Midcoast Scanner Page yourself. If you have local knowledge or can help verify information, your input can be valuable to the community. Many scanner pages rely on volunteer moderators and contributors to keep the information accurate and up-to-date. By actively participating, you can help ensure that the Midcoast Scanner Page remains a reliable and informative resource for everyone.
